House Made Corned Beef Hash Recipe

Inspired by Red Stripe
Time30m
Serves2

Served with two eggs any style and grilled toast.

Method

Cooking Instructions

  1. 1

    Prepare the Potatoes

    In a large pot, add diced potatoes and cover with water. Bring to a boil and cook until just tender, about 8-10 minutes. Drain and set aside.

  2. 2

    Sauté the Vegetables

    In a large skillet, heat olive oil or butter over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and bell pepper. Sauté until softened, about 5-7 minutes.

  3. 3

    Combine Ingredients

    Add the cooked potatoes and diced corned beef to the skillet. Season with salt and black pepper. Stir to combine and cook until the mixture is heated through and the potatoes are slightly crispy, about 10-15 minutes, stirring occasionally.

  4. 4

    Cook the Eggs

    In a separate pan, cook the eggs to your preference (scrambled, fried, or poached).

  5. 5

    Serve

    Serve the corned beef hash on a plate, topped with the cooked eggs and alongside grilled toast.
